如何快速查询电脑本机IP地址?三种主流方法详解

一、命令行工具查询法(跨平台通用方案)

命令行查询是技术人员最常用的高效方法,其优势在于无需依赖图形界面,在服务器环境或远程连接场景下尤为实用。

Windows系统操作流程

  1. 启动命令提示符
    按下Win+R组合键打开运行窗口,输入cmd后回车。在黑色命令窗口中,输入ipconfig命令并执行。系统将返回所有网络适配器的配置信息,包括:

    • 有线连接:标识为以太网适配器 以太网
    • 无线连接:标识为无线局域网适配器 WLAN
  2. 定位关键参数
    在目标适配器信息块中,查找IPv4 地址字段(格式如192.168.1.100)。若需获取更详细的网络信息,可使用增强命令:

    1. ipconfig /all # 显示所有网络配置细节
    2. ping 127.0.0.1 # 验证本地网络协议栈状态

macOS/Linux系统操作流程

  1. 打开终端窗口
    通过Spotlight搜索(macOS)或Ctrl+Alt+T(Linux)启动终端。

  2. 执行网络诊断命令
    输入以下命令获取IP信息:

    1. ifconfig # 传统BSD风格命令(部分新系统需安装net-tools)
    2. ip addr show # 现代Linux系统推荐命令

    输出结果中,inet字段对应IPv4地址,inet6字段对应IPv6地址。

  3. 快速过滤IP地址
    使用管道符配合grep命令精准提取信息:

    1. ip addr show | grep "inet " | grep -v "127.0.0.1"

二、系统设置图形化查询法(适合新手用户)

图形化界面提供了更直观的操作路径,特别适合不熟悉命令行的用户群体。

Windows 10/11系统

  1. 访问网络状态面板
    右键任务栏网络图标,选择网络和Internet设置。在状态页面点击属性按钮(需先选择当前连接的网络类型:以太网或Wi-Fi)。

  2. 查看物理地址与IP配置
    在硬件属性页面可同时获取:

    • IPv4/IPv6地址
    • 子网掩码
    • 默认网关
    • MAC物理地址

macOS系统

  1. 进入网络偏好设置
    点击屏幕左上角苹果图标,选择系统偏好设置网络

  2. 获取连接详情
    在左侧选择当前使用的连接方式(Wi-Fi或以太网),点击高级按钮。切换至TCP/IP选项卡即可查看IP配置信息。

三、控制面板深度查询法(兼容旧版系统)

该方法适用于需要访问完整网络配置信息的场景,特别适合处理复杂网络环境。

Windows系统操作路径

  1. 打开网络共享中心
    通过控制面板(Win+X控制面板)进入网络和共享中心,或直接在文件资源管理器地址栏输入control.exe /name Microsoft.NetworkAndSharingCenter

  2. 分析连接状态
    点击当前活动连接(蓝色链接文字),在弹出的状态窗口中:

    • 观察活动字段确认连接状态
    • 点击属性按钮可修改网络协议配置
    • 点击详细信息获取完整网络参数
  3. 导出配置信息
    在详细信息窗口中,可通过复制功能将配置信息保存至文本文件,便于技术文档编写或故障申报。

四、特殊场景处理方案

  1. 多网卡环境管理
    在虚拟机或服务器场景下,系统可能配置多个网络适配器。建议:

    • 使用route print(Windows)或ip route(Linux)命令查看路由表
    • 通过netstat -rn(macOS)确认默认网关配置
  2. 动态IP与静态IP识别

    • DHCP分配的地址会标注自动配置 IPv4 地址
    • 手动设置的静态IP会在备用配置或协议属性中显示
  3. IPv6地址查询
    在命令行工具中,IPv6地址通常标注为IPv6 地址inet6字段。现代操作系统默认启用双栈协议,建议同时记录IPv4和IPv6地址。

五、安全注意事项

  1. 隐私保护
    避免在公共论坛直接公开完整IP地址,特别是公网IP可能暴露地理位置信息。

  2. 命令权限
    在Linux/macOS系统执行网络命令时,可能需要sudo权限获取完整信息。

  3. 服务验证
    获取IP后建议通过pingtelnet命令验证网络连通性,例如:

    1. ping 8.8.8.8 # 测试基础网络连通
    2. telnet example.com 80 # 验证端口可达性

掌握这些查询方法后,用户可快速定位网络配置问题,为VPN连接、远程桌面访问、本地服务部署等操作奠定基础。建议技术人员收藏本文作为网络故障排查的标准操作流程参考。